The Importance of Calculating Aquarium Size

Accuracy matters in fish keeping. Knowing the exact water volume of an aquarium is not just a matter of interest; it affects numerous important elements of maintenance:

  • Stocking Limits: The principle of "one inch of fish per gallon of water" is a vast simplification, however water volume stays the standard for figuring out how lots of fish a tank can safely support.
  • Medication Dosages: Under-dosing medication can fail to cure sick fish, while over-dosing can be fatal. Accurate water volume computations guarantee precise treatment.
  • Water Conditioners and Additives: Adding the correct quantity of dechlorinator, fertilizers, or pH adjusters relies completely on knowing the exact gallons or liters in the system.
  • Devices Sizing: Filters, heating systems, and lighting systems are ranked based upon tank volume.

Standard Aquarium Shapes and Their Formulas

While custom tanks come in endless configurations, most fish tanks fall into basic geometric shapes. Calculating volume requires basic geometry.

Below are the standard solutions used to determine the volume of water an aquarium holds. ( Note: To convert cubic inches to United States liquid gallons, divide the overall cubic inches by 231. For liters, divide cubic centimeters by 1,000).

1. Rectangle-shaped Aquariums

Without a doubt the most common shape, rectangle-shaped tanks are straightforward to calculate. Measure the interior length, width, and water height in inches.

2. Round Aquariums

Round or tower tanks need the formula for the volume of a cylinder, utilizing the radius (half of the size) and the height.

Common Aquarium Dimensions and Volumes

To help envision standard sizes, the table below details typical Aquarium Tank Calculator measurements and their approximate overall water volumes (measured in United States Gallons and Litres).

Tank TypeMeasurements (L x W x H in inches)Approximate US GallonsApproximate Litres
Requirement 10 Gallon20" x 10" x 12"10 Gallons38 Litres
Standard 20 Long30" x 12" x 12"20 Gallons76 Litres
Standard 29 Gallon30" x 12" x 18"29 Gallons110 Litres
Requirement 40 Breeder36" x 18" x 16"40 Gallons151 Litres
Standard 55 Gallon48" x 13" x 21"55 Gallons208 Litres
Standard 75 Gallon48" x 18" x 21"75 Gallons284 Litres
Standard 90 Gallon48" x 18" x 24"90 Gallons340 Litres

Note: These computations represent total physical volume. Real water volume will be a little lower once substrate, driftwood, rocks, and the gap at the top of the tank are factored in.


Step-by-Step Guide: How to Calculate Water Volume in an Existing Tank

If an aquarium is currently set up, calculating the specific water volume can be challenging due to the fact that designs and substrate displace water. Follow these steps for an accurate measurement:

  1. Measure the Water Level: Measure the height of the water from the top of the substrate to the water surface (not the total height of the glass).
  2. Measure Length and Width: Measure the interior length and width of the glass.
  3. Use the Formula: Multiply Length × Width × Height (in inches) and divide by 231.
  4. Account for Displacement: As a basic general rule, heavy aquascaping (lots of rocks, big driftwood, and thick substrate) can displace 10% to 15% of the calculated water volume. Deduct this percentage to discover the true water volume.

Physical Space Planning: Beyond Water Volume

Determining aquarium size is not simply about water capacity; it is likewise about guaranteeing the space and furniture can physically accommodate the setup. Water is incredibly heavy.

The Weight Factor

A gallon of freshwater weighs approximately 8.34 pounds (3.78 kg). Saltwater is slightly heavier at approximately 8.55 pounds per gallon.

When determining the total weight of an Aquarium Tank Calculator, one must factor in:

  • Water weight (Gallons × 8.34 lbs)
  • Glass or acrylic tank weight
  • Substrate (sand and gravel are heavy)
  • Rocks, driftwood, and devices

Total Weight Estimation for Popular Sizes

Tank SizeEstimated Water WeightApproximated Total Weight (With Tank, Stand, & & Decor)
10 Gallon~ 83 pounds~ 110 pounds (49 kg)
20 Gallon~ 166 lbs~ 225 pounds (102 kg)
55 Gallon~ 458 lbs~ 625 pounds (283 kg)
75 Gallon~ 625 pounds~ 850 pounds (385 kg)

Warning: Never put a medium-to-large Aquarium Water Calculator on basic home furniture like bookshelves or cabinets. Always use a ranked Aquarium Pump Size Calculator stand created to distribute weight uniformly.


Key Considerations for Choosing Your Aquarium Size

When choosing the ideal Aquarium Calculator Gallon size to compute and buy, keep the following biological and practical factors in mind:

  • Footprint vs. Height: For the majority of fish, the horizontal footprint (length and width) is even more important than height. Fish swim back and forth, not up and down. A long, shallow tank (like a 40-breeder) provides more swimming territory and much better gas exchange than a tall, narrow tank of the exact same volume.
  • Water Stability: A common mistaken belief is that small tanks are easier to preserve. In truth, big bodies of water are a lot more stable. In a 5-gallon tank, an error in feeding or a sudden spike in ammonia can be fatal within hours. In a 75-gallon tank, the environment has enough buffer to absorb minor fluctuations securely.
  • Maintenance Access: Consider the physical reach needed for maintenance. Deep tanks (over 24 inches) typically require specific long-handled tools or perhaps stepping stools to reach the substrate throughout water changes.
